In livestock and horse management, behavioral science optimizes both welfare and productivity:
Wearable tech, such as smart collars, allows veterinarians to track real-time behavioral data. Changes in sleep patterns, scratching frequency, and heart rate variability provide objective metrics of an animal’s mental and physical health before clinical symptoms appear. Selective Serotonin Reuptake Inhibitors (SSRIs) like fluoxetine or tricyclic antidepressants (TCAs) like clomipramine are frequently prescribed for severe separation anxiety, compulsive disorders, and territorial aggression. These medications do not sedate the animal; instead, they lower the emotional baseline of panic so that behavior modification protocols can actually take effect. 5.
